Vestee Jackson

Vestee finished his college career with 13 interceptions from 1983–1985 at the University of Washington.

[1] Jackson was selected in the second round (55th overall) by the Bears in the 1986 NFL draft.

[2][3] He played eight seasons in the NFL, mostly with the Chicago Bears (1986–1990) and the Miami Dolphins (1991–1993).

With the Miami Dolphins, he contributed 3 interceptions in 1992 but would retire after the 1993 season.
